> Does the A165 work as a Eurorack to "S" trig converter? I was wondering about triggering a Korg SQ10 sequencer. > > > David > > www.movingisliving.co.uk The possible use of the A-165 as S trigger converter depends upon the direction: If you have an S-Trigger signal that has to be converted into a voltage trigger a pull-up resistor has to be added. The procedure is described on the A-100 DIY page on our website. If a voltage trigger has to be converted into a "real" S trigger (i.e. pure switching to GND) another modification is necessary: one has to remove R2 and use the collector output of Q1 as S trigger output. But in many cases not a "real" S trigger is required but only the inverted signal. In this case simply use the inverted output of the module. I'd try out if this works before you start the modification.
